Node Connectivity Performance
Node Connectivity Performance refers to the efficiency and speed at which a specific network node communicates with other nodes within a decentralized ledger or trading protocol. In the context of financial derivatives and cryptocurrency, this metric determines how quickly transaction data, order book updates, and consensus messages propagate across the network.
High performance ensures that a node remains synchronized with the global state, minimizing latency for market participants. Poor connectivity can lead to stale price information, which is detrimental in high-frequency trading or when managing liquidation risks.
It encompasses factors such as bandwidth availability, peer discovery protocols, and the geographical distribution of connected peers. Ultimately, it is the technical backbone that supports timely execution and reliable price discovery in digital asset markets.
